Median Rent
Shawnee, OK: $867/mo (midpoint of 1BR/2BR) · Newport, RI: $1,532/mo
Median rent in Newport, RI is $665/mo higher than in Shawnee, OK.
Median Home Price
Shawnee, OK: $147,800 · Newport, RI: $669,500
Median home price in Newport, RI is $521,700 higher than in Shawnee, OK.
Median Household Income
Shawnee, OK: $54,281 · Newport, RI: $83,562
Newport, RI has a higher median household income than Shawnee, OK by $29,281.
